Brazil’s state-owned Petrobras drives diesel prices up by a further 8.9%

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- On May 9, Petrobras announced a further 8.9% increase in diesel prices at refineries, against the express wishes of President Bolsonaro. From May 10, the average price per liter will go from R$4.51 (US$0.88) to R$4.91.
